About the role

  • Maintenance Manager overseeing production machinery and maintenance team in Kansas City. Responsible for budget, compliance, and strategic planning to ensure reliability and efficiency in operations.

Responsibilities

  • Associates in the Maintenance Leader position are responsible for leading the Maintenance team and keeping all Flexible Packaging machines and support equipment in proper operating conditions.
  • The position will support PPC’s ability to produce quality flexible packaging materials on time while assuring that Associates comply with all applicable safety and quality control procedures.
  • This role is responsible for building maintenance planning, reliability systems, and cost discipline that support stable production and long-term asset performance.
  • Maintenance Leader are expected to be “On call” 24 hours a day, 7 days per week.
  • Expected to maintain all mechanical equipment and systems within the facility and grounds except those maintained by service agreements established with outside vendors.
  • Owns the maintenance budget, including annual budget planning, review of prior three years of maintenance spend and labor utilization, forecasting, variance analysis, and cost-control initiatives that reduce reactive maintenance, overtime, and emergency repairs while improving asset reliability and uptime.
  • Communicates with every shift to assign work duties and reviews actual performance from the previous 24 hours.
  • Emphasizes continuous learning by discussing root cause of mechanical failures or breakdowns, and reviews key procedures that impact costs and quality control.
  • Establishes a rolling 8-week maintenance planning and scheduling process, including weekly maintenance schedules and coordination with production planning to reduce reactive work.
  • Holds Associates accountable for compliance with all quality control, productivity, safety, housekeeping, GMP, SQF, and ISO standards, and communicates expectations and procedures.
  • Establishes a productive tempo on the plant floor by working with a steady and purposeful pace and presence in the plant.
  • Insists that the Maintenance team works proactively and with a sense of urgency to facilitate systematic and timely repairs to all manufacturing and support equipment.
  • Maintains a proactive “Preventative Maintenance Program” on all production and key non-production pieces of equipment.
  • Provides work instruction to the Maintenance Technicians for “Preventative Maintenance” based on set parameters for each piece of equipment.
  • Makes sure that Maintenance Technicians document key repairs and records the materials and parts needed for the repairs.
  • Maintains an inventory of key replacement parts, hardware, lubricants, and operating materials that may be specialized to the various production departments.
  • Drives strict compliance with all GMP and food safety policies that pertain to the maintenance functions within the facility.
  • Trains, guides, and assists Associates in the successful execution of their roles.
  • Coordinates training of new Associates by assigning a qualified trainer, and monitoring the timely completion and documentation of the training program.
  • Maintains a safe and secure workplace, responsible for the mechanical operation of the plant and its contents.
  • Assumes the role of “Acting Plant Manager” during the off-shifts and any time the Plant Manager is not on the premises.
  • Monitors and enforces Associates’ breaks for both rule compliance and productivity. Ideally coordinates breaks in each department to keep machines running as much time as possible.
  • Administers progressive disciplinary procedures as required.
  • Ensures accuracy of payroll records, and provides performance evaluations and pay reviews for Associates in a timely and objective manner.
  • Attends and participates in weekly Production Leadership Meetings.
  • Ensures that all responsibilities and functions performed are in accordance with company procedures as set forth in the Personnel Handbook.
  • Participates in Safety programs.
  • Supports the company emphasis on teamwork and cooperation to achieve our goals by performing other duties as assigned including periodic cleanup issues.
  • Covers time for Maintenance Technicians for vacation and sick days.
  • Generates improvement ideas and embraces improvement projects to better the business.
  • Implements maintenance KPIs and reporting related to uptime, downtime, PM compliance, maintenance cost, and reliability performance.
  • Works cross-functionally with Production, Quality, Planning, and CI to improve equipment reliability, planned downtime execution, and production readiness.
  • Collaborates with maintenance and operations leadership at the Turner facility to align maintenance standards, preventative maintenance programs, spare-parts strategy, and reliability practices in support of a unified PPC Kansas City maintenance system.
